Reliable User Datagram Protocol
出典: フリー百科事典『ウィキペディア(Wikipedia)』
| TCP/IP群 | |
|---|---|
| アプリケーション層 | |
|
BGP / DHCP / DNS / FTP / HTTP / IMAP / IRC / LDAP / MGCP / NNTP / NTP / POP / RIP / RPC / RTP / SIP / SMTP / SNMP / SSH / Telnet / TFTP / TLS/SSL / XMPP カテゴリ |
|
| トランスポート層 | |
|
TCP / UDP / DCCP / SCTP / RSVP カテゴリ |
|
| ネットワーク層 | |
|
IP (IPv4、IPv6) / ICMP / ICMPv6 / NDP / IGMP / IPsec カテゴリ |
|
| リンク層 | |
|
ARP / OSPF / SPB / トンネリング (L2TP) / PPP / MAC (イーサネット、IEEE 802.11、DSL、ISDN) カテゴリ |
Reliable User Datagram Protocol(RUDP)は、Plan 9のためにベル研究所で設計されたトランスポート層のプロトコルである。
保証されたパケット送出をするためには、UDPではあまりに原始的だが、TCPでは、プロトコル上のオーバヘッドが大きすぎる。そこで、RUDPは、UDPに以下のような機能をTCPより少ないオーバーヘッドで拡張したものである。
- 受信パケットの確認応答
- ウィンドーイングとフロー制御
- 欠損パケットの再送
- リアルタイムストリーミングより速いオーバーバッファリング
RUDPは現在、正式な規格ではないが、1999年にIETFのインターネットドラフトで記述された。標準化のための提案はされていない。